| Description | The REDP provides large grants to fund renewable energy power generation demonstration projects using various technologies across a range of geographic areas, up to one third of the eligible expenditure on each project. The grants support the commercialisation and deployment of large scale, grid feeding, renewable energy projects. The REDP opened on 20 February 2009 and applications closed 15 April 2009. Four non-solar projects were announced on 6 November 2009: Two geothermal projects (AUD 90 million and AUD 62 million), one ocean energy (AUD 66 million), and one integrated energy (AUD 15 million) were successful. Two solar thermal projects (AUD 60 million and AUD 32 million) were announced on 11 May 2010. |
